A 250 Mils banknote from Cyprus, dated June 1, 1974. This note is in good overall condition, showing signs of circulation but still retains its unique charm.

Notably, this banknote was printed just a month before the Turkish invasion of Cyprus, which began on July 20, 1974. This context adds historical significance to the note, marking a pivotal moment in Cypriot history. 

Details:

Issuer: Republic of Cyprus
Type: Standard banknote
Years: 1964-1982
Value: 250 Mils (0.250)
Currency: Pound (decimalized, 1955-1982)
Composition: Paper
Size: 125 × 73 mm
Shape: Rectangular
